You have a large bottle of 2% saline solution in the lab (2% NaCl, which is sodium chloride). You need 5 ml of 0.1% saline for an experiment. Do the calculation for the dilution you would need to make (i.e., calculate the volume of 2% saline and the volume of water you would need to combine).

Answer:

volume of 2% saline (V₁) = 0.25ml

volume of water = 4.75ml

Step-by-step explanation:

The requirement in the question is to obtain 0.1% of NaCl from 2% NaCl, and the process is dilution. The general dilution equation is guven by:

C₁V₁ = C₂V₂

where:

C₁ = initial concentration = 2%

V₁ = initial volume = ?

C₂ = final concentration = 0.1%

V₂ = final volume = 5ml

C₁V₁ = C₂V₂

calculating for V₁

∴ V₁ = (C₂V₂) ÷ C₁

= (0.1% × 5) ÷ 2%

V₁ = 0.25ml

Now, let us calculate the volume of water needed:

V₁ + Volume of water = V₂ (volume of 0.1% NaCl)

0.25 + volume of water = 5

volume of water = 5 - 0.25

volume of water = 4.75ml
